
Basal Cell Carcinoma
OncologyOverview
A malignant skin tumor arising from cells at the base of the epidermis. It grows slowly, rarely metastasizes, and commonly presents as a slowly enlarging nodule or a non-healing ulcer.
Symptoms
- Skin nodule
- Non-healing ulcer
- Local pigmentation
- Raised border
- Slow enlargement
Treatment
Treatment is mainly surgical resection, and may also use radiotherapy or local therapy; prognosis is good. Specialist evaluation is required.
